The greatest fullback in Stanford history, Ernie Nevers earned the title “America’s all-time one-man team” for prowess in all aspects of football. An All-American, he was voted to College Football’s All-Time All-America Team by consensus of the Football Writers of America and NCAA in 1969. Nevers earned 11 letters as a collegian, excelling in football, baseball, and basketball. He pitched professional baseball with the St. Louis Browns before his pro football career. While with the Cardinals, he scored an NFL record of 40 points in one game. He is a 1963 charter member of the Pro Football Hall of Fame.

Inducted into the Bay Area Sports Hall of Fame in 1980.
